No. 10) 17 18 Plaintiff Edeltraud Hagiwara is a prisoner proceeding pro se with this civil rights action 19 20 pursuant to 42 U.S.C. § 1983. The matter was referred to a United States Magistrate Judge 21 p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 636(b)(1)(B) and Local Rule 302. On July 2, 2020, the assigned magistrate judge screened the complaint and found that 22 23 plaintiff had failed to state a cognizable claim. (Doc. No. 10 at 4–5.) The magistrate judge then 24 issued findings and recommendations, recommending that the action be dismissed without leave 25 to amend. (Id. at 5.) The findings and recommendations were served on plaintiff and contained 26 notice that any objections were to be filed within fourteen (14) days of service. (Id.) No 27 objections have been filed, and the time to do so has now passed. 28 ///// 1 1 In accordance with the provisions of 28 U.S.C. § 636(b)(1)(B) and Local Rule 304, the 2 court has conducted a de novo review of the case. Having carefully reviewed the entire file, the 3 court concludes that the findings and recommendations are supported by the record and proper 4 analysis. 5 Accordingly: 6 1. 7 8 The findings and recommendations issued on July 2, 2020 (Doc. No. 10) are adopted in full; 2. Plaintiff’s First Amended Complaint is dismissed without leave to amend due to plaintiff’s failure to state a cognizable claim; 9 10 3. All pending motions are denied as moot; and 11 4. The Clerk of the Court is directed to close this case. 12 13 IT IS SO ORDERED.
